You are using the Ashampoo Firewall.
I'm afraid that is the culprit. AFAIK this FW prevents Avast from updating and Ashampoo has stated that there is no solution currently available.

My advice would be to uninstall Ashampoo FW and check.

If that helped, then leave Ashampoo go with Online Armor or Outpost (both have free versions).

Absolutely agree on Ashampoo firewall being the culprit, many such cases in the forums.

In one of the most recent ones they actually got an acknowledgement from Ashampoo that they had a problem with avast.setup and the only resolution was uninstalling ashampoo firewall.
